naturally
nat·u·ral·ly / ˈnachərəlē/ • adv. 1. in a natural manner, in particular: ∎ in a normal manner; without distortion or exaggeration: act naturally. ∎ as a natural result: one leads naturally into the other. ∎ without special help or intervention: naturally curly hair.2. as may be expected; of course: naturally, I hoped for the best.
